一躺网络联系电话 18202186162 17661491216

一躺网络科技负责任的全网营销代运营公司

订制网站开发(网站定制开发公司哪家好)
订制网站开发(网站定制开发公司哪家好)
订制网站开发是一种根据客户的具体需求和要求,从零开始设计和开发的完全个性化的网···
开发定制知识

网站模板中的Lazy Loading技术应用

返回列表 作者: 一躺网络编辑部 发布日期: 2025-06-10

网站模板中的Lazy Loading技术应用

在构建动态和交互式网站时,Lazy Loading技术是提高用户体验的关键因素之一。这种技术通过延迟加载页面元素,直到用户滚动到它们的位置,从而减少首屏的加载时间并提升页面响应速度。本文将详细介绍Lazy Loading技术的应用及其对SEO的影响。

让我们理解什么是Lazy Loading。Lazy Loading是一种前端优化技术,它允许开发者在用户滚动到特定可视区域后才加载相关的图像、脚本或内容。这样做的好处包括:

  1. 减少首屏加载时间:由于只有在用户滚动到所需内容时才加载这些内容,首屏的加载时间明显缩短,提高了页面的加载速度。
  2. 提升用户体验:更快的页面加载速度能够增强用户的浏览体验,因为用户可以更快地找到他们需要的信息。
  3. 节省带宽:由于只有当用户滚动到特定位置时才加载内容,因此减少了不必要的数据传输,从而节省了带宽。
  4. 搜索引擎优化(SEO):对于搜索引擎来说,快速加载的页面意味着更高的排名机会。Lazy Loading技术有助于提高网站的SEO性能。

让我们探讨Lazy Loading技术在网站模板中的实现方法。一种常见的方法是使用CSS的:not()伪类选择器来延迟加载某些元素。例如,如果一个图片只在页面的中部出现,可以使用以下代码将其延迟加载:

/* CSS */
.image-class::before {
content: url("path/to/your/image.jpg");
display: none;
}
/* HTML */

在这个例子中,::before伪元素被用来模拟图片的显示。当用户滚动到该元素所在的位置时,图片才会被实际加载。

除了上述技术,还有其他一些方法可以应用Lazy Loading技术。例如,使用JavaScript监听滚动事件,并在用户滚动到特定位置时执行相应的操作。这可以通过监听scroll事件来实现:

// JavaScript
window.addEventListener('scroll', function() {
if (/* 条件判断 */) {
// 执行加载逻辑
}
});

还可以结合AJAX技术实现异步加载,这样即使页面已经加载完成,也可以在用户滚动到特定位置后异步加载其他内容。这种方法特别适用于那些需要大量数据加载的内容,如视频或复杂的图表。

值得注意的是,虽然Lazy Loading技术能显著提升用户体验和SEO表现,但它也可能带来一些副作用。例如,过度依赖Lazy Loading可能导致页面加载时间过长,影响页面的整体性能。因此,在使用Lazy Loading技术时,应权衡其利弊,确保用户体验和SEO效果之间的平衡。

Lazy Loading技术是现代网站开发中不可或缺的一部分,它不仅能够显著提升用户体验,还能为SEO带来积极影响。通过合理应用Lazy Loading技术,开发者可以创造出既快速又内容丰富的网站。

全国服务热线

18202186162
在线客服
服务热线

服务热线

18202186162

微信咨询
二维码
返回顶部